什么是服务器客户机

不及物动词 其他 27

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器和客户机是计算机网络中的两个重要概念,它们在网络通信和数据传输中起着不同的作用。

    服务器是指在网络中提供服务的计算机,它可以提供各种服务,如文件存储、网站托管、数据库管理、邮件传输等。服务器通常具备强大的计算和存储能力,并且能够同时处理多个客户端请求。服务器主要负责处理客户机的请求,并将相应的数据或服务发送给客户机。

    客户机是指使用和请求服务的计算机,它通过网络与服务器建立连接,并向服务器发起请求。客户机可以是桌面电脑、笔记本电脑、智能手机等各种终端设备。客户机的主要任务是向服务器发送请求,并接收服务器返回的数据或服务。

    在网络通信中,客户机和服务器之间通过网络协议进行数据交互。客户机向服务器发起请求时,会发送一个请求消息,请求的内容可以是访问网页、下载文件、发送电子邮件等。服务器接收到请求后,会进行相应的处理,并将结果以响应消息的形式返回给客户机。

    服务器和客户机之间的通信可以通过局域网、广域网或互联网进行。当客户机与服务器在同一个局域网内时,通信速度比较快;而当客户机和服务器之间距离较远时,通信速度可能较慢,需要经过多个网络节点的中转。

    总结起来,服务器是提供服务的计算机,负责处理客户机的请求;而客户机是使用服务的计算机,向服务器发起请求并接收响应。服务器和客户机通过网络协议进行通信,实现数据传输和服务交互。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器和客户机是计算机网络中常见的两种角色。服务器是指提供服务的计算机,它可以存储和管理数据、运行应用程序,并通过网络向其他计算机提供服务。客户机是指使用服务器提供的服务的计算机,它通过网络连接到服务器,并发送请求获取所需的服务或数据。

    以下是关于服务器和客户机的一些要点:

    1. 功能区别:服务器主要负责存储和管理数据、运行应用程序,并提供服务,如网站托管、文件共享、数据库管理等。客户机主要用于访问和使用服务器提供的服务,如浏览网页、下载文件、发送电子邮件等。

    2. 资源分配:服务器通常具有较高的计算能力、存储容量和网络带宽,可以同时为多个客户机提供服务。客户机通常较低配置,依赖服务器的资源来完成任务。

    3. 数据传输:客户机通过网络连接到服务器,可以通过协议如HTTP、FTP、SMTP等访问服务器提供的服务。客户机发送请求给服务器,服务器接收请求并处理,然后将结果返回给客户机。

    4. 安全性:由于服务器存储和管理大量的数据,对服务器来说安全性非常重要。服务器通常使用防火墙、加密技术等来保护数据的安全性。客户机也需要采取一些安全措施,如使用防病毒软件、更新操作系统补丁等,以保护自己的信息安全。

    5. 角色关系:在一个计算机网络中,通常有多个客户机连接到一个服务器上。客户机可以同时连接到多个服务器,获取不同的服务。服务器可以管理多个客户机的请求,并为它们提供服务。

    综上所述,服务器是提供服务的计算机,负责存储和管理数据、运行应用程序,并通过网络向客户机提供服务;客户机是使用服务器提供的服务的计算机,通过网络连接到服务器,并发送请求获取所需的服务或数据。服务器和客户机在计算机网络中扮演不同的角色,相互配合,实现数据和服务的传输和共享。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器客户机,又称为客户服务器模式(Client-Server Model),是一种计算机系统架构模型,用于网络环境下的分布式计算。在该模型中,服务器和客户机之间通过网络进行通信,服务器提供各种服务和资源,而客户机通过请求这些服务和资源来进行工作。

    在服务器客户机模式中,服务器被设计为集中存放和处理数据、提供各种服务和资源的计算机。客户机则是通过网络与服务器进行通信,并通过请求访问服务器上的数据和服务来完成工作。

    下面是服务器客户机模型的一般操作流程:

    1. 客户机发送请求:客户机通过网络发送请求到服务器。请求可以是获取某个文件、执行某个操作、访问某个服务等。

    2. 服务器处理请求:服务器接收到客户机发送的请求后,根据请求的内容进行相应的处理。服务器可能需要提取、处理或存储数据,执行特定的操作或提供某项服务。

    3. 服务器发送响应:服务器在完成请求处理后,向客户机发送相应的响应。响应可以是请求的数据、操作的结果或服务的访问权限等。

    4. 客户机接收响应:客户机接收服务器发送的响应,并进行相应的处理。客户机可能需要显示响应的数据、解析响应的结果或根据响应的权限进行进一步操作。

    服务器客户机模型有以下几个特点:

    1. 分布式处理:服务器和客户机分别负责不同的任务,可以将计算和存储等任务分散到不同的机器上,提高了整体的处理能力。

    2. 资源共享:服务器提供各种服务和资源,多个客户机可以同时访问和共享这些资源。例如,在一个局域网中,多个客户机可以通过服务器共享打印机、文件存储等设备。

    3. 灵活性和可维护性:服务器客户机模型可以根据需要进行扩展和维护。当需要增加服务或资源时,只需要在服务器上进行相应的改变,而不需要改变所有的客户机。

    4. 安全性:服务器客户机模型可以设置不同的访问权限和安全措施,保护服务器上的数据和资源不被未经授权的用户访问。

    总而言之,服务器客户机模型通过有效的分布式计算和资源共享,提供了一种高效、可扩展和安全的计算架构。这种模型在现代计算领域得到广泛的应用,例如云计算、Web服务等。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部